What is the difference between Remote Sedentary vs Remote Customer Service Representative?

AspectRemote SedentaryRemote Customer Service Representative
Primary RolePerforming administrative, data entry, or clerical tasksHandling customer inquiries, support, and service
Required SkillsOrganization, computer proficiency, data managementCommunication, problem-solving, patience
Work EnvironmentHome office, computer-based tasksHome office, customer interaction via phone or chat
Common CertificationsNone typically requiredCustomer service or communication certifications optional

Remote Sedentary jobs focus on administrative and clerical tasks, often requiring organizational skills and computer proficiency. Remote Customer Service Representatives primarily handle customer interactions, requiring strong communication skills. While both are remote and sedentary, their roles differ in purpose and skill set, making them distinct career paths within remote work opportunities.

What are some strategies for maintaining productivity and well-being while working in a remote sedentary role?

In a remote sedentary role, it's important to develop routines that balance productivity with personal well-being. Setting a structured daily schedule, taking regular short breaks to stretch or move, and creating a dedicated workspace can help maintain focus and efficiency. Additionally, communicating proactively with your team and utilizing collaboration tools ensures you stay connected and aligned on tasks. Implementing these practices can help prevent burnout and promote a healthy work-life balance.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ote sedentary worker?

To excel as a remote sedentary worker, you generally need strong computer literacy, time management, and self-motivation, often supported by a high school diploma or higher education relevant to the industry. Familiarity with collaboration tools like Zoom, Slack, and cloud-based productivity suites such as Microsoft Office or Google Workspace is typically required. Excellent written communication, adaptability, and self-discipline are crucial soft skills for effective remote work. These abilities ensure productivity, clear communication, and reliable performance in a virtual, self-directed environment.

What are remote sedentary jobs?

Remote sedentary jobs are positions that can be performed from home or any location outside a traditional office and typically require minimal physical activity. These jobs mainly involve sitting at a desk and working on a computer or phone for most of the workday. Common examples include data entry, customer service representative, virtual assistant, writer, or software developer. Remote sedentary jobs are ideal for individuals who prefer flexible work environments and have reliable internet access.

Physical Demands Level:

  • Sedentary Work - Exerting up to 10 pounds of force occasionally (occasionally means activity or conditions exist up to 1/3 of the work day), and/or, a negligible amount of force frequently (frequently means activity or condition exists from 1/3 to 2/3 of the work day) to lift, carry, push, pull, or otherwise move objects, including the human body. Sedentary work involves sitting most of the time but may involve walking or standing for brief periods of time. Jobs are sedentary if walking and standing are required only occasionally and all other sedentary criteria are met.
